The First Aid at Work (FAW) Refresher Course in Cardiff is a comprehensive two-day requalification programme designed for those whose existing FAW certification is nearing its expiry date. Completing this training enables you to renew your Level 3 FAW qualification for an additional three years, ensuring you remain certified to deliver first aid in accordance with workplace safety requirements.
Unlike the full three-day First Aid at Work course, this refresher concentrates on updating your theoretical understanding and reinforcing practical skills through instructor-led exercises. It ensures you continue to meet all Health and Safety Executive (HSE) standards and maintain confidence in handling real-life emergencies at work.
The First Aid at Work Refresher Course in Cardiff is available to anyone who currently holds a valid First Aid at Work (FAW) certificate. To prevent your qualification from expiring and needing to complete the full three-day course again, it’s advisable to reserve your spot before your existing certificate runs out.
If your certificate has recently expired, you can still join this 2-day requalification course within a 28-day grace period. However, if it has lapsed beyond that window, you’ll need to restart your training with the complete FAW programme to regain certification.
Participants are required to present proof of their valid or recently expired FAW certificate on the first day of training to confirm their eligibility.

The First Aid at Work Refresher Course in Cardiff is evaluated through a combination of trainer observation, hands-on demonstrations, and a brief multiple-choice assessment. These assessments are designed to confirm that you can confidently apply the techniques and procedures revisited throughout the training.
Upon successful completion, participants receive a renewed Level 3 First Aid at Work certificate. This qualification remains valid for three years and is fully endorsed by the Health and Safety Executive (HSE), confirming your compliance with UK workplace first aid standards.
It’s easy to confuse the short annual refresher with the formal 2-day FAW Requalification course. The annual refresher serves as a brief skills update to help first aiders maintain confidence year-round, but it does not extend or renew your qualification.
If your certificate is approaching its expiry date, enrolling in the 2-day First Aid at Work Refresher (Requalification) course is essential. This is the only officially recognised programme that renews your Level 3 FAW qualification for another three years and ensures you remain fully compliant with HSE requirements.

The FAW Refresher in Cardiff is open to anyone holding a valid First Aid at Work (FAW) certificate or one that has recently expired within the 28-day grace period. You’ll be asked to show proof of your current or recently expired certificate on the first day of the course.
If your certificate expired less than 28 days ago, you can still join the Cardiff refresher course. However, if it has been longer, you’ll need to complete the full 3-day First Aid at Work qualification again to renew your certification.

This refresher course runs over two days, with each day lasting about six to seven hours, including breaks. It’s a shorter option compared with the full three-day First Aid at Work programme.
The Cardiff FAW Refresher revisits all essential first aid topics such as CPR, AED use, managing bleeding and burns, fractures, and major medical emergencies including heart attack, stroke, asthma, epilepsy, and diabetes.
Assessment is carried out through practical demonstrations, trainer observation, and a short multiple-choice test to confirm your understanding of the course material.

The Annual Refresher is a short skills-maintenance session designed to keep your knowledge sharp each year, but it does not renew your certificate. Only the two-day FAW Refresher in Cardiff extends your qualification for another three years.
